App Suite Releases
  • 8.35
  • 7.10.6
Imprint
  • 8.35
  • 7.10.6
Imprint
  • Release 8.38
  • Release 8.37
  • Release 8.36
  • Release 8.35
  • Release 8.34
  • Release 8.33
  • Release 8.32
  • Release 8.31
  • Release 8.30
  • Release 8.29
    • Noteworthy Changes
      • Important Changes
      • App Suite Middleware
    • Changelogs
      • App Suite UI
      • App Suite Middleware
      • Additional Components
        • AI Service
        • OX Guard UI
        • OX Guard
  • Release 8.28
  • Release 8.27
  • Release 8.26
  • Release 8.25
  • Release 8.24
  • Release 8.23
  • Release 8.22
  • Release 8.21
  • Release 8.20
  • Release 8.19
  • Release 8.18
  • Release 8.17
  • Release 8.16
  • Release 8.15
  • Release 8.14
  • Release 8.13
  • Release 8.12
  • Release 8.11
  • Release 8.10

App Suite Middleware

8.29.0 - 2024-08-28

Added

  • MW-2319: Token Login Variant for PWA Onboarding
    • Breaking Change: The file tokelogin-secrets has been removed. See also:
    • SCR-1405: Renamed parameter in /login?action=redeemToken
    • SCR-1406: Added a client defined expiration time to /token?action=acquireToken
    • SCR-1407: Replaced tokenlogin-secrets file with lean configuration
  • MW-2323: Adjust Helm Charts for Redis 7.4
  • MW-2339: Deputy-Management via Provisioning API
  • MW-2353: Documentation for Redis and Active/Active

Changed

  • MW-2043: Upgraded scribe library to v8.3.3
  • MW-2360: Added support for a special Redis instance dedicated for cache data
  • MW-2365: Adjusted hazelcast documentation
  • MWB-2698: Introduced aliases for sieve script names
  • SCR-1425: Removed Replacement of "email 1" by "default sender address"
  • SCR-1428: Deprecation of JCS-based "CacheService"
  • SCR-1432: Updated Netty libraries from v4.1.111 to v4.1.112
  • SCR-1433: Updated lettuce library from v6.3.2 to v6.4.0
  • SCR-1440: Updated OSGi target platform bundles
  • SCR-1441: New Configuration Property "com.openexchange.oidc.staySignedIn"
  • Inject 'preferred' hint for user's primary mail address within
  • SCR-1448: Upgraded dnsjava from v3.5.3 to v3.6.1
  • SCR-1450: Removed org.eclipse.osgi.services helper bundle
  • SCR-1451: Updated Google Guava from v33.2.1 to v33.3.0
  • Avoid recursive delete calls if PluginException occurred (2) -
  • Use compact representation for folder user properties
  • Use reverse order in CalDAV:calendar-user-address-set property for Thunderbird/Lightning

Removed

  • MW-2367: Remove Xing integration
  • SCR-1426: Removed "FilteringObjectStreamFactory" Service and parent Bundle "com.openexchange.serialization"

Fixed

  • Added checks for pretty old messages that should not occur #23
  • Consider possible MX records on ISPDB look-up for a possible mail account setup #24
  • Optimized reading schema state (update tasks) #10
  • Defer dependent capability checks
  • Inject fallback display name for *DAV-based subscriptions if missing #22
  • MWB-2512: Use 'no-reply' account for synthetic push sessions
  • MWB-2530: Orderly compile path to a shared folder from target user's point of view
  • MWB-2667: Deny writing rules requiring unsupported capabilities
  • MWB-2701: Replace possible space characters in URLs with appropriate URL encoded representation (%20)
  • MWB-2702: Properly compare user mail aliases with punycode
  • MWB-2705: Fixed writing JSlob IDs as JSON array to channel
  • Orderly track new cache service in IMAP bundle #8
App Suite UI
Additional Components